Objective:To investigate the risk factors for acute kidney injury (AKI) in elderly patients with severe fever with thrombocytopenia syndrome (SFTS).Methods:A retrospective analysis was performed on 414 elderly patients with SFTS admitted to Weihai Central hospital from April 2016 to October 2024.According to the occurrence of AKI, patients were divided into the AKI group (n=120) and the non-AKI group (n=294).Clinical indicators were compared between the two groups.Logistic regression was used to identify risk factors for AKI in SFTS patients.A Nomogram model was constructed based on the identified risk factors, and receiver operator characteristic (ROC) curve was used to analyze the predictive value of Nomogram model and risk factors.Results:Multivariate logistic regression analysis showed that platelet count ( OR=0.977, 95% CI: 0.966-0.988, P<0.001), baseline creatinine value ( OR=1.044, 95% CI: 1.026-1.062, P<0.001), serum uric acid / albumin ratio ( OR=1.215, 95% CI: 1.142-1.293, P<0.001) were independent risk factors for AKI in elderly SFTS patients.The ROC curve analysis showed that the area under the curve (AUC ) of the Nomogram model was 0.884, significantly higher than those of serum uric acid / albumin ratio (AUC=0.836), baseline creatinine(AUC=0.793)and platelet count(AUC=0.725)( Z=3.085, 4.747, 6.101, all P < 0.05). Conclusions:Serum uric acid/albumin ratio, baseline creatinine value and platelet count are significant risk factors for AKI in elderly patients with SFTS.The Nomogram model based on these three variables significantly improves the prediction accuracy of AKI in elderly patients with SFTS.
